[dynamo](https://docs.nvidia.com/dynamo/latest) reports 7.8k GitHub stars, 1.5k forks, and 1.3k open issues, last pushed Aug 24, 2026. [beta9](https://beam.cloud) has 1.8k stars, 158 forks, and 21 open issues, last pushed Aug 19, 2026. Figures are from public GitHub metadata via [dynamo's repository](https://github.com/ai-dynamo/dynamo) and [beta9's repository](https://github.com/beam-cloud/beta9).

| | [dynamo](/tools/ai-dynamo-dynamo.md) | [beta9](/tools/beam-cloud-beta9.md) |
| --- | --- | --- |
| Tagline | A Datacenter Scale Distributed Inference Serving Framework | Ultrafast serverless GPU inference, sandboxes, and background jobs |
| Stars | 7,845 | 1,753 |
| Forks | 1,486 | 158 |
| Open issues | 1,270 | 21 |
| Language | Rust | Go |
| Adopt for | Dynamo is a Rust-built framework for large-scale distributed inference serving, aimed at efficient management and deployment of machine learning models in a datacenter environment. | beta9 is an ultrafast serverless GPU inference platform with sandbox environments and background job capabilities. Noteworthy features include its focus on large language model inference and environment management. |
| Persona | - | - |
| Runtime | - | - |
| License | Other | AGPL-3.0 |
| Categories | Inference & Serving | Inference & Serving, LLM Frameworks |
